Ok, what's really going on? At least partially, I was thinking of going to Scarbourough Faire, [this is the last weekend], but with the forecast for rain, rain, rain, it didn't seem reasonable.

So, I've got a mix of being pissed at the weather [always useful] and pissed at myself for being a procrastinating wuss.

